    "Modernes Hotel mit neuen Zimmern"
    Ich habe dieses Hotel auf einer Geschäftsreise gebucht. Mein Zimmer wurde kurz zuvor neu renoviert. Die Ausstattung ist gut und die Zimmer sind außerordentlich geräumig. Die Lage ist direkt an einer Hauptverkehrsstraße, allerdings ist es auf den Zimmern trotzdem ruhig. Das Frühstück kann im Restaurant nebenan gebucht werden. Die Auswahl ist gut. Bemängeln kann ich nur, dass ich für Softdrinks nochmal separat bezahlen musste.

    "Could do better"
    First impressions aren't great to be honest. The place looks a little tired, could do with a touch-up of external paint. Very small reception area, and even though we arrived at 6pm the reception was very busy and queuing at the door. We were met by a lovely lady who booked us in quickly. We were allocated a room on the 3rd floor and proceeded to take our bags to the room. I immediately noticed that we were in a room with an adjoining room - there were only two of us so this was not required. Although the door was locked, I could still hear the TV next door and could see feet underneath. Privacy was therefore zero. I went back downstairs and complained and was told we could move....so why not put us in a suitable room in the first place? If a standard double was available, why not just allocate us one? This is where frustrations grew, as they then wouldn't allow me the new room key to do a straightforward move, we were expected to bring all our bags back downstairs to reception to check in again. Thankfully were not elderly and could carry our bags, but still, it was an inconvenience. Do not allocate people adjoining rooms if they do not ask for one. Simple. Our new room was clean, although we had to carry up our towels in additional to our bags. The adjoining bar area is a little sad, with only one lovely young lady manning the bar. This was a Friday night and incredibly busy, shame on Premier Inn for expecting her to run it alone. Cocktails were on offer, but there was no way she could make these given how busy the bar was, so everyone had to settle for a standard drink. Based on this, we only stayed for one drink. We wanted to go for a drink the next day (Saturday afternoon), but the bar was shut. Overall we had an ok stay but would we return? No. The location is too far out from the centre of Cleethorpes (although there is a bus stop outside), the place looks untidy, room allocation is poor and the bar operates at a slow pace.
